Creating A New Website - Top 10 Tips

Daniel Woodford • Apr 21, 2021

Build Your New Website For Success

Designing and maintaining a website is part art and part science.  To help maximize the engagement for your new website, we recommend considering these Top 10 Tips when planning your next website project.

#1. Use Pictures & Videos To Tell Your Story


Unfortunately, the old “Reading Is Fundamental” no longer applies. Studies show that customers focus more on pictures and videos today to learn about your brand, products or services. So use visuals that evoke an emotion and keep your copy to a minimum, leveraging bulleted copy and well-honed headlines whenever possible. Best practices include:


  • Utilize authentic pictures of your team, work, products, events, etc.
  • Use of high-contract visuals can draw your visitors attention to a key product, call-to-action or value proposition
  • Consistently leverage key visuals across your website and social media properties to build brand cohesion


#2. Make Sure Your Site is Fast


Make sure it’s fast because if it takes too long to load, customers will easily get impatient and will leave your site before they even learn what you do.


  • Utilize tools like Google’s Page Speed Insights to test the speed of your site. Test your website here.
  • Loading speed also affects your ranking within search engines like Google
  • Make sure your videos and images are optimized on your website


#3. Secure Sites (HTTPS) Are A Must


If you see that little padlock in the address bar of your web browser, you're visiting a secure website. Even if your website is primarily an informational site (and you're not selling products or services directly from your site), it's still highly recommended to use HTTPS.


  • Having a secure website improves your rank on search engines
  • If your customer is visiting your unsecure website from their work computer, in many cases access will be blocked by the customer’s employer 
  • HTTPS protects the integrity of communication between a website and a user's browsers. Your users will know that the data sent from your web server has not been intercepted and/or altered by a third party in transit


#4. Use Backlinking Strategies


A “backlink” is simply a link from one website to another. Search engines like Google use backlink as a ranking signal because when one website links to another, it means they believe the content is noteworthy.


  • Backlinks are especially valuable for SEO because they represent a "vote of confidence" from one site to another
  • If many sites link to the same webpage or website, search engines can infer that content is worth linking to, and therefore also worth surfacing on a Search Engine Results Page (SERP)


#5. Design for Mobile First


Globally, over 68% of all website visitors came from mobile devices. While it’s important to ensure you website looks great on desktop, tablets and mobile devices, you should design with a “Mobile First” strategy in mind. Ensure the following:


  • Make it easy for customers to “Click to Call” my business
  • Contact Forms are optimized and simplified for mobile users
  • Site navigation is simple minimal options
  • Make copy large enough for easy reading

#7. Less Is More


When listing product options and service options, keep the list as brief as possible and order them for best engagement:


  • Reduce the number options a customer can choose from. Too many options can stop the decision process completely
  • Limit the number of fields to complete on your forms
  • Focus on one call-to-action
  • Linking to social media pages from your website is great but only for networks where you are active
  • List your most important products first


#8. Use Color To Set The Tone


Every color evokes a different emotion. The use of an exhilarating red is great for high-energy brands like fitness companies and adventure travel. Use of complimentary blacks and golds can portray a premium look & feel for financial services companies or high-end luxury brands.


  • Pick a color palette and stay consistent across your website and social properties
  • Choose a primary color and then set rules around supporting and accent colors
  • Ensure your chosen colors play well together and create a consistent balance


#9. Make Text Easy To Read


Everyone wants their brand to be unique and to stand out but be certain to stick to fonts that are easy to read. 


  • Don’t use an obscure font. Pick a font that is very easy to read
  • Use concise headlines. Less is more
  • Leverage white space to draw a viewer’s eyes to headlines and important copy points
  • Ensure the font size on all devices is large enough (but not too large) to easily read
